Greetings fellow travelers and explorers of the cosmos! Today’s journey takes us from the vibrant streets of Singapore to the quaint charm of Seremban, Malaysia. Strap in as we recount our adventures through the lens of fantasy and science fiction!

Our day began with the rising sun, beckoning us to embark on another adventure. After a hearty breakfast, we packed our belongings, readying ourselves for the next leg of our odyssey. A quick Grab ride to the post office allowed us to send off some postcards, a ritual of connection to our loved ones back home.

As fate would have it, our path intertwined with that of an older English couple, fellow wanderers with whom we shared stories of our travels. Together, we navigated the labyrinthine bus station, eventually finding our way out of Malaysia and onto a bus bound for the futuristic skyline of Singapore.

Crossing the bridge between nations, we marveled at the bustling traffic, a symphony of movement and energy. Armed with entry forms, we made our way through passport control, though alas, no stamp adorned our passports, a minor disappointment in the grand tapestry of our journey.

Guided by the hum of technology, we traversed the city, hopping on metros towards our hostel, a bastion of modernity amidst the urban sprawl. After a leisurely lunch, we ventured into the verdant oasis of the botanic garden, where exotic flora danced in the breeze and elusive otters remained elusive. But a sign reminded us to let them cross the road first, if we would ever come across one.

The evening found us wandering the luminous avenues of Marina Bay, where skyscrapers reached for the stars and gardens bloomed amidst steel and glass. A feast of Indian cuisine awaited us at a hawker center, followed by sweet treats of ice cream nestled between waffles.

We were joined by friends from Sesy's university days for the water and light show at Marina Bay. Afterwards, we headed over to another mesmerizing symphony of illumination at the garden by the bay. As the night grew late, we bid adieu and made our way back to our sanctuary, the promise of rest beckoning us under the city’s gleaming skyline.

 

25.02.

With the dawn of a new day, we prepared to bid farewell to Singapore’s embrace. After a leisurely breakfast, we embarked on one final exploration of Chinatown, where vibrant artwork adorned the facades of historic buildings.

Nourished by flavorful noodles, we retraced our steps, gathering our belongings for the journey ahead. Crossing the border once more, we found ourselves back in Malaysia, where the scent of adventure hung in the air.

A brief interlude at a shopping mall offered respite, though our quest for fresh juice remained unfulfilled. Undeterred, we pressed on, eventually boarding a bus bound for Seremban two hours later than expected.

Shortly past midnight we got off in the settlement where we would spend the night. According to maps.me a few steps would take us to the tavern we booked for the night. However, when we arrived at the point marked by maps.me it was nowhere to be seen. We wandered through the streets nearby but remained unsuccessful. A few locals spotted us and asked if they could help. After telling our destination a girl insisted that it was too far and too late in the night for us to walk there. She convinced her partner that the only right thing for them to do is drive us there. So these absolutely lovely characters brought us to our surprisingly big tavern where we checked in with some minor difficulties. Eventually we fell into the bed exhausted.
